哈希游戏,稳定策略的关键哈希游戏稳定策略

哈希游戏,稳定策略的关键哈希游戏稳定策略,

本文目录导读:

  1. 哈希算法的基本原理
  2. 哈希算法在游戏中的应用
  3. 稳定策略的重要性
  4. 实际案例分析

嗯,用户让我写一篇关于“哈希游戏稳定策略”的文章,还给了标题和内容的要求,我得弄清楚什么是哈希游戏,哈希通常是指哈希函数,它在密码学和数据结构中很常见,可能和游戏有关联吗?可能是指使用哈希算法来设计游戏机制,比如公平分配资源或者防止作弊。

用户还要求写一个标题,我得想一个吸引人的标题,哈希游戏:稳定策略的关键”或者“哈希算法在游戏中的稳定应用策略”,然后是内容,不少于2810字,所以需要详细展开。

我得分析用户的需求,用户可能是一个游戏开发者,或者是对游戏机制感兴趣的人,他们可能希望了解如何利用哈希算法来确保游戏的公平性和稳定性,避免滥用或不公平现象。

文章结构方面,可能需要先介绍哈希的基本概念,然后讨论其在游戏中的应用,接着分析稳定策略的必要性,再详细阐述策略的具体实施方法,最后总结其重要性,这样逻辑清晰,内容全面。 部分,我需要解释哈希函数的工作原理,比如输入转换为固定长度的输出,以及它的单向性和确定性,结合游戏场景,比如玩家注册、资源分配、交易系统等,说明哈希如何应用,比如在游戏里防止 cheat,可以通过哈希来验证玩家数据的真实性。

稳定策略方面,可能需要讨论如何设计规则,防止滥用哈希漏洞,比如防止提前计算哈希值,或者防止哈希碰撞,可以提出具体的策略,比如使用强哈希算法,设置时间限制,或者引入其他机制来验证玩家行为。

用户可能还希望看到实际案例,比如Epic Games的虚幻5中使用哈希防止 cheat,或者区块链中的应用,这些例子能增强文章的说服力。

总结哈希在游戏中的重要性,强调稳定策略如何提升游戏体验和公平性,可能还要提到未来的发展趋势,比如随着AI的进步,哈希的应用会不会有新的挑战,如何应对。

我得确保文章结构合理,内容详实,满足字数要求,可能需要分几个部分,每个部分深入探讨一个方面,确保逻辑连贯,信息准确,语言要专业但易懂,适合目标读者阅读。

在当今数字娱乐产业中,游戏开发越来越依赖于各种技术手段来确保游戏的公平性、安全性和用户体验,哈希算法作为一种强大的数学工具,正在被广泛应用于游戏开发中,哈希算法通过将输入数据转换为固定长度的哈希值,确保数据的完整性和不可篡改性,从而为游戏中的资源分配、玩家行为验证、交易系统等提供可靠的基础保障。

本文将深入探讨哈希算法在游戏开发中的应用,重点分析如何通过稳定策略确保游戏机制的公平性和安全性,我们将从哈希算法的基本原理出发,结合游戏开发中的实际案例,详细阐述哈希算法在游戏中的重要性,并提出一些实用的策略建议,以帮助开发者构建更加稳定的游戏系统。

哈希算法的基本原理

哈希算法(Hash Algorithm)是一种将任意长度的输入数据转换为固定长度的哈希值的数学函数,其核心特性包括:

  1. 确定性:相同的输入数据始终生成相同的哈希值。
  2. 不可逆性:已知哈希值无法推导出原始输入数据。
  3. 抗碰撞性:不同的输入数据产生不同哈希值的概率极小。
  4. 高效性:哈希函数的计算速度快,适合大规模数据处理。

这些特性使得哈希算法在数据 integrity 和安全验证方面具有广泛的应用潜力。

哈希算法在游戏中的应用

资源分配与公平性

在多人在线游戏中,资源分配是影响玩家体验的重要因素,通过哈希算法,游戏可以确保资源分配的公平性,游戏可以使用哈希算法来计算玩家的贡献值,然后根据贡献值进行资源分配,这样,每个玩家的资源分配结果都是基于其行为的哈希值,确保了分配的公平性和透明性。

防止 cheat 与作弊检测

哈希算法在防止 cheat 中发挥着重要作用,在需要验证玩家真实身份的游戏中,可以将玩家的注册信息(如用户名、密码)哈希后存储在服务器端,玩家在游戏中进行行为操作时,系统可以再次计算其哈希值,并与存储的哈希值进行比对,从而验证玩家行为的真实性,这种方法不仅能够防止 cheat,还能有效防止玩家滥用账号。

交易系统与虚拟货币

在区块链游戏或虚拟货币游戏中,哈希算法被广泛应用于交易系统中,游戏中的交易行为可以被记录为哈希值,然后通过哈希链的方式实现不可篡改的交易记录,这种方式不仅能够确保交易的公正性,还能有效防止欺诈行为。

玩家行为验证

哈希算法还可以用于验证玩家的游戏行为,在需要验证玩家是否在游戏中进行过特定行为时,可以将该行为的哈希值与存储的哈希值进行比对,这种方法不仅能够确保验证的准确性,还能有效防止玩家滥用系统功能。

稳定策略的重要性

在游戏开发中,稳定策略是确保系统正常运行的关键,哈希算法的应用也不例外,必须通过稳定策略来保证其可靠性和安全性,以下是一些关键的稳定策略:

选择合适的哈希算法

不同的哈希算法有不同的特性,选择合适的哈希算法是确保系统稳定性的基础,在需要高抗碰撞性的系统中,可以使用SHA-256或SHA-384等算法;而在需要快速计算的系统中,可以使用MD5或SHA-1等算法。

强制玩家验证

为了防止玩家滥用系统功能,可以强制玩家进行验证,在需要验证玩家身份的系统中,可以要求玩家提供其哈希值,而不是直接提供原始数据,这样,即使玩家账号被盗,也无法通过盗用的原始数据进行验证。

时间戳验证

为了防止玩家提前计算哈希值,可以将哈希值与时间戳结合使用,在验证玩家行为时,可以要求玩家提供其行为的哈希值和当前时间戳,这样,即使玩家提前计算了哈希值,也无法通过时间戳的不一致来完成验证。

多层验证机制

为了进一步提高系统的安全性,可以采用多层验证机制,在验证玩家行为时,可以同时验证哈希值和行为的真实性,这样,即使玩家通过了一次验证,也必须通过其他验证才能完成行为验证。

实际案例分析

Epic Games的虚幻5

在虚幻5游戏中,哈希算法被广泛应用于 cheat 检测系统中,游戏使用哈希算法来验证玩家的账号信息,并通过哈希链的方式记录玩家的作弊行为,这种方法不仅能够有效防止 cheat,还能为玩家提供一个公平的游戏环境。

区块链游戏

在区块链游戏中,哈希算法被用于构建哈希链,每个区块的哈希值都与前一个区块的哈希值相关联,形成一个不可篡改的链,这种方法不仅能够确保游戏数据的完整性和不可篡改性,还能有效防止欺诈行为。

哈希算法在游戏开发中的应用,为游戏的公平性、安全性和用户体验提供了强有力的支持,通过稳定策略的实施,可以确保哈希算法在游戏中的稳定性和可靠性,随着哈希算法技术的不断发展,其在游戏中的应用也将更加广泛,为游戏行业的发展注入新的活力。

哈希游戏,稳定策略的关键哈希游戏稳定策略,

发表评论